oh, and btw, it wouldnt have been a 3-peat for national champions, it would have been a 3-peat AP championship.  the BCS system is stupid but it was the agreed upon system that caused LSU, not USC, to become national champions 2 years ago.  there are no longer co-champions, and even so there have been undefeated teams such as a few Jo-Pa teams that have been undefeated and not won the national championship in the past.  love it or hate it, the BCS is the official system and USC only won 1 national championship in the last 3 years.  I was certainly upset 3 years ago when USC didnt get a chance to play LSU, but that's what happens with the BCS.  

Is Auburn any less a champion last year with 2 running backs that did very well this year in the NFL as rookies?  not in my opinion.  they were just as undefeated as USC the previous year.  but they also were not officially national champions.  oh well.
